LMAO! You guys have to got to be kidding me. I bet everyone who had something negative to say don't live here.
I lived here all my life and Jamaica is way too big to say "yes" it's bad. Jamaica has some run down areas and they also have some very rich areas.
The worst part is South Jamaica/Guy R Brewer Blvd and some parts of Rockaway Blvd as some have mentioned.
If you tell me what zip codes you are looking into I can tell you ye or ne.
